Under the SAVE Act, "if you are a woman that has changed your name from your birth certificate, let's say through marriage ---you are no longer eligible to vote." Politifact called this mostly false
The proof is in the bill
https://roy.house.gov/sites/evo-subsites/roy.house.gov/files/evo-media-document/119th%20-%20HR%208281_Signed.pdf
When I try to cut and paste the relevant sections, it doesn't paste correctly, but you want Section 2, which lays out what you can use for ID. If your married name is on your passport, you're okay. But if you don't have a passport, you will need a birth certificate, and that will be your name at birth, not your married name, nor your hyphenated name.
You can read a full analysis by the Brennan Center here: https://www.scribd.com/document/354176622/The-Effects-of-Requiring-Documentary-Proof-of-Citizenship#fullscreen&from_embed
If you read section 2, and the Brennan Center report, you'll see that there are all sorts of problems proving who someone is, especially if their name has changed.
